在人工智能领域,长短期记忆网络(LSTM)和门控循环单元(GRU)等循环神经网络(RNN)模型在处理序列数据时表现出色。然而,随着数据集的规模和复杂性的增加,传统的RNN模型逐渐暴露出其局限性。长短期预测(Long Short-Term Prediction,LFP)模型作为一种新型的循环神经网络,旨在解决传统RNN在长序列预测中的挑战。本文将探讨LFP模型的技术难题,并通过实战案例分析解决路径与优化策略。
一、LFP模型概述
LFP模型是一种基于LSTM的改进版,它通过引入遗忘门和输入门来增强模型对长序列数据的处理能力。LFP模型通过以下特点实现了对传统RNN的优化:
- 遗忘门:允许模型在处理长序列时遗忘不重要的信息,保留关键信息。
- 输入门:控制新的信息如何影响细胞状态,使得模型能够更好地学习序列中的长期依赖关系。
- 输出门:决定模型在特定时间步输出哪些信息,提高预测的准确性。
二、LFP模型的技术难题
尽管LFP模型在理论上具有优势,但在实际应用中仍面临以下技术难题:
- 过拟合:由于LFP模型包含多个参数,容易在训练过程中出现过拟合现象。
- 梯度消失和梯度爆炸:在长序列预测中,梯度消失和梯度爆炸问题仍然存在,影响模型的训练效果。
- 计算复杂度:LFP模型在处理大规模数据集时,计算复杂度较高,导致训练和预测速度慢。
三、实战案例分析
案例一:股票价格预测
在股票价格预测的案例中,LFP模型通过学习股票历史价格数据,预测未来的价格走势。以下为解决路径与优化策略:
- 数据预处理:对股票价格数据进行标准化处理,减少过拟合风险。
- 特征工程:提取与股票价格相关的特征,如交易量、开盘价、收盘价等。
- 模型优化:通过调整学习率、批处理大小等参数,优化模型性能。
案例二:文本生成
在文本生成的案例中,LFP模型通过学习文本序列,生成新的文本内容。以下为解决路径与优化策略:
- 数据预处理:对文本数据进行分词、去停用词等操作,提高模型对文本的理解能力。
- 模型优化:引入注意力机制,使模型更加关注序列中的重要信息。
- 生成策略:采用贪心策略或采样策略,生成高质量的文本内容。
四、优化策略
针对LFP模型的技术难题,以下优化策略可提高模型性能:
- 正则化:采用L1、L2正则化等方法,降低过拟合风险。
- dropout:在训练过程中,随机丢弃部分神经元,提高模型泛化能力。
- 迁移学习:利用预训练的LFP模型,在特定任务上进行微调,提高模型性能。
- GPU加速:利用GPU加速LFP模型的训练和预测过程,提高计算效率。
五、总结
LFP模型作为一种新型的循环神经网络,在处理长序列数据时表现出色。然而,在实际应用中,LFP模型仍面临过拟合、梯度消失/爆炸等挑战。通过实战案例分析,本文提出了相应的解决路径与优化策略,为LFP模型在实际应用中的推广提供了参考。
